I can't recall a band falling so far down the totem pole so quickly without some sort of external driver. Granted, Motley weren't anywhere near a stadium-level act on their own going into the Stadium Tour, but they were doing solid business before they did their farewell tour. You'd think they'd be able to continue to tour at that level, but the demand has disappeared. I don't know how much of it has to do with Mick (a minority of the people in the crowd have any idea who's on stage), the band's reputation for terrible "live" performances (I doubt the casual fan has any idea), resentment for going back on their silly "cessation of touring" promise (they're not the first and won't be the last) or if it's a combination of all the above.
The Stadium Tour was a perfect package -- a zeitgeist-y / moment in time recaptured / strength in numbers kind of thing. Maybe Bon Jovi / Def Lep could do similar business. As for Motley? I'm not sure they'd sell tickets at this point even if they did another farewell tour.
